A driver who decided it would be a good idea to make a three-point turn in the middle of the Gotthard Tunnel is facing fines of CHF 3,500.
For reasons that aren’t clear – the German driver decided he didn’t want to continue his journey towards Ticino and turned back shortly after entering the tunnel.
The Uri cantonal prosecutor says the manoeuvre was ‘grossly careless’.
The fine also includes the fact the car didn’t have an autoroute vignette.
